The Last Echo of Redemption
In the shadowy realm of the Invincible, a knight named Thorne had once been a beacon of hope and a symbol of invincibility. But as the darkness crept closer, his armor tarnished, and his heart grew heavy with the weight of his actions. The Last Echo of Redemption tells the story of Thorne's descent into despair and his ultimate journey to redemption.
It was a moonless night when Thorne stood at the precipice of a chasm, his armor clinking softly with each step. The Invincible had once been his name, but now it was but a whisper in the wind. The knights of the Invincible had been tasked with protecting the realm from the encroaching darkness, but their leader, the High Commander, had succumbed to the allure of power and had betrayed them all.
Thorne's tale begins with a haunting question: How does a hero become a villain? As he wanders the treacherous paths of the Invincible, he encounters the remnants of his former allies, each one a ghost of what they once were. They speak of the High Commander's twisted vision of a perfect world, one that required the sacrifice of their souls.
In a world where trust is a luxury few can afford, Thorne finds himself navigating a labyrinth of lies and deceit. The path to redemption is not clear, and the cost of his past mistakes is steep. He encounters a mysterious figure known as the Shadow Walker, who appears to know more about the High Commander's true intentions than anyone else in the realm.
The Shadow Walker reveals that the High Commander is not the only one who has succumbed to the darkness. The entire kingdom has been corrupted, and the true heart of darkness lies within the heart of the realm itself. Thorne is forced to question everything he thought he knew about the world he once protected.
As Thorne delves deeper into the heart of darkness, he discovers a hidden truth about the Invincible's origin. The knights were once chosen for their purity of heart and unwavering devotion to the realm, but the High Commander's ambition had led him to seek an ancient artifact that would grant him ultimate power. In his quest for power, he had corrupted the essence of the Invincible, turning it into a vessel of darkness.
Thorne's journey takes him to the heart of the realm, where the High Commander awaits with his army of the corrupted knights. The climactic battle that follows is intense and emotional, as Thorne must confront his inner demons and face the High Commander, who has become a twisted version of the hero he once admired.
In a final act of self-sacrifice, Thorne manages to defeat the High Commander and destroy the artifact, thus lifting the corruption from the realm. However, the cost is great, and Thorne is forced to accept that some heroes must end their own stories to save others.
The Last Echo of Redemption concludes with Thorne's descent into the chasm, his armor now a relic of a bygone era. As he vanishes into the abyss, the realm begins to heal, but the darkness lingers, waiting for the next hero to emerge.
The story leaves readers with a poignant reflection on the nature of heroism and the price of redemption. Thorne's journey is a testament to the human condition, where the line between good and evil is often blurred, and the heart of darkness can be found within the most unexpected places.
